PoE (Power over Ethernet) cameras are especially valuable for scalability. They use a single cable for both power and data, reducing clutter and installation complexity. More importantly, they integrate seamlessly with switches and recorders, allowing you to add new cameras without reconfiguring your entire network. This modularity is key for small businesses that plan to expand coverage over time.

Mapping Zones and Prioritizing Coverage

Before buying equipment, map out your surveillance zones. Entrances, cash registers, storage rooms, and parking areas are high-priority targets. Each zone may require a different type of camera—wide-angle for lobbies, infrared for low-light areas, and high-resolution for facial recognition. By segmenting your space, you avoid overbuying and ensure each camera serves a specific purpose.

Once your zones are defined, choose cameras that support centralized management. Many IP models from brands like Dahua and Hikvision allow remote access, motion-triggered alerts, and cloud backups. These features aren’t just convenient—they’re essential for business owners who need to monitor multiple areas or locations from a single dashboard.

Planning for Storage and Retention

As your system grows, so does your data. High-resolution footage consumes bandwidth and storage quickly, especially if you’re recording 24/7. That’s why choosing the right NVR or cloud storage plan is critical. Look for recorders that support multiple channels, compression formats like H.265, and scalable hard drive bays. These features ensure your system can handle increased footage without sacrificing performance.

Also consider retention policies. Do you need to store footage for 7 days, 30 days, or longer? Legal requirements vary by industry, and having a system that can adapt to those needs protects you from compliance issues. The Foundation of Personalization

Personalization begins with data. Marketers rely on subscriber information—names, demographics, purchase history, and engagement patterns—to craft messages tailored to individual preferences. But if the email address itself is invalid, inactive, or riddled with errors, the entire personalization effort collapses.

Imagine a campaign designed to recommend products based on past purchases. If a portion of the list contains fake or mistyped addresses, those messages never reach their intended recipients. Not only does this waste resources, but it also skews performance metrics, making it difficult to measure the true impact of personalization. Verification ensures that every address in your database belongs to a real, reachable person, providing a solid foundation for meaningful personalization.

Segmentation That Actually Works

Segmentation is the practice of dividing your audience into smaller groups based on shared characteristics, such as location, behavior, or interests. The goal is to deliver content that feels relevant to each segment. But segmentation is only as strong as the data behind it. If your list is cluttered with invalid or outdated addresses, your segments become unreliable.

For example, a travel company might want to target subscribers in specific regions with tailored offers. Without verification, the list may include addresses tied to inactive accounts or incorrect domains, leading to wasted sends and distorted engagement data. By cleaning the list, verification ensures that each segment reflects real, active subscribers, allowing marketers to deliver campaigns that truly align with audience needs.

Understanding Patent Searches: A Crucial Step in the Invention Process

A patent search is a fundamental aspect of the invention process, serving as a pivotal checkpoint to gauge the uniqueness and patentability of a new creation. By conducting a comprehensive patent search, inventors can identify existing patents and technical literature that may conflict with their invention idea. This process not only validates the novelty of an invention but also helps in shaping and refining the concept to align with the requirements of patentability.

Purpose and Importance of Patent Searches

The primary purpose of a patent search is to assess the novelty of an invention and determine whether it meets the criteria for patent protection. It involves examining previously granted patents, pending patent applications, and other relevant technical literature to ascertain if similar concepts or inventions exist. By doing so, inventors can gain a better understanding of the existing intellectual property landscape in their respective field of innovation.

Conducting a patent search is vital for several reasons:

  • Validating Novelty: A thorough search helps inventors confirm that their invention is indeed novel and doesn’t infringe upon existing patents.
  • Shaping the Invention: Discovering similar patents allows inventors to refine and enhance their invention idea to ensure it stands out in the market.
  • Avoiding Infringement: Identifying existing patents can help prevent potential legal conflicts and infringement issues in the future.

Do I Need a Prototype and Can InventHelp Assist? While having a prototype can greatly enhance the presentation and marketability of an invention, it is not always a prerequisite for patenting an idea. In many cases, a detailed description and drawings that sufficiently illustrate the invention’s functionality and design may be adequate for the patent application process.

However, developing a prototype offers several advantages:

  • Concept Validation: Prototypes allow inventors to validate the functionality and feasibility of their invention in real-world scenarios, providing valuable insights for further refinement.
  • Demonstration and Marketing: A prototype serves as a powerful visual and functional representation of the invention, making it easier to attract investors, licensees, and potential partners.
  • Enhanced Patent Application: A well-developed prototype can substantially strengthen the patent application by demonstrating the practical implementation and potential impact of the invention.

Understanding Patents

A patent is an exclusive right granted by the government to an inventor, allowing them to prevent others from making, using, selling, or distributing the patented invention without permission. Patents are a form of intellectual property protection that covers new inventions, including processes, machine designs, manufactured goods, and chemical compositions. By obtaining a patent, inventors secure a monopoly over their invention for a specified period, typically 20 years from the filing date for utility and plant patents in the United States.

The Importance of Creating a Prototype

While patents protect the idea, the importance of creating a prototype for your invention idea cannot be overstated. A prototype is a preliminary version of a product that allows inventors, investors, and prospective customers to interact with it physically. It serves multiple purposes in the invention process. Firstly, it helps identify any design flaws or necessary improvements, saving time and resources in the long run. Secondly, a prototype is crucial for demonstrating the functionality and appeal of the invention to potential investors or licensors, providing a tangible proof of concept that can significantly enhance pitches and presentations.

Moreover, having a prototype can facilitate the patent application process. A well-crafted prototype can help clarify the innovation’s unique aspects, making it easier to define the claims of the patent application. It also reinforces the investor’s commitment and the potential of the invention to stakeholders.

Why Kids Look for Fake IDs and What Parents Can Do

Adolescence is a critical period of experimentation, pushing boundaries, and identity formation. It’s during this time that some young people may be attracted to the idea of using a fake ID to gain access to age-restricted activities. To better protect them, parents should understand the motivations behind this behavior and actively communicate with their children to help them navigate a safer path.

Reasons behind the Fake ID Appeal

Search for Independence

Adolescents often seek ways to assert their independence and separate themselves from parental supervision. Acquisition of a fake ID may provide an opportunity to engage in activities that they perceive as more “grown-up,” and thus, establish their autonomy.

Peer Pressure and Social Desires

An intense desire to fit in with peers can lead to pressure – both direct and indirect – to obtain and use fake IDs. Young people may fear being excluded or ridiculed if they are unable to participate in age-restricted activities with their friends. Access to Restricted Activities

The primary incentive for obtaining a fake ID is to gain access to age-restricted activities such as purchasing alcohol, attending parties, or entering clubs. The thrill of engaging in such “forbidden” activities may be hard to resist, especially for those who are close to the legal age.

What Parents Can Do

Know the Signs

Parents should be vigilant for the signs of fake ID use or attempts to purchase one. These may include changes in friends or social circles, sudden interests in age-restricted events, and unexplained absences or evasive behaviors.

Open Communication

Establishing trust and maintaining an open dialogue with your teenager is vital. Encourage honest conversations about the decisions they face, including peer pressure and fake ID temptations. Share your own experiences, if appropriate, and let them know that you understand the challenges of growing up.

Discuss the Consequences

Make sure your adolescent is aware of the legal, social, and moral consequences that can come from using a fake ID. This includes potential fines, criminal charges, or jeopardizing their future prospects in education and employment. Emphasize the importance of making wise choices with lasting impacts on their lives.

Offer Support

Assure your teenager that you are always available to discuss their problems or concerns. Encourage them to seek your perspective and guidance rather than resorting to fraudulent behavior. Encourage participation in supervised and age-appropriate social activities, as this can help satisfy their needs for autonomy and peer interaction while minimizing the appeal of fake IDs.

Be a Good Role Model

Demonstrate responsible decision-making and adherence to the law in everyday life. Your actions serve as a powerful example to your adolescent, teaching them the importance of upholding ethical values and making good choices.
